TEN POINTS !!!!! if f(x)=x^2-6x and g(x)=x^3 squared what is (fog) (x)

Respuesta :

Stephen46
Stephen46 Stephen46
  • 04-07-2020

Answer:

f(x) = x² - 6x

g(x) = (x³)² = x^6

( f o g) x

Wherever you see x in f(x) replace it by g(x)

That's

( f o g)(x) = (x^6)² - 6(x^6)

= x^12 - 6x^6
